What Is AI Text to Speech Software?

First of all, what is AI text to speech software? Text to speech technology, commonly shortened to TTS, is a type of technology that converts digital text into speech. With applications spanning from the content creation process to education, accessibility for the visually impaired, and more, you can find TTS technology being used in countless ways. Almost every kind of personal electronic device is capable of TTS whether it’s a cell phone, tablet, or computer.

Why Use a TTS App for Videos?

The advancement of TTS technology from the simplistic, robotic-sounding vocal synthesizers of decades past to the AI text to speech software capabilities of today is incredible. Content creators are using TTS apps for more than just streamlining their editing process, they’re also using AI text to speech software to make their videos more accessible to everyone.

For example, the World Health Organization cites that at least 2.2 billion people worldwide have a form of vision impairment. AI text to speech software allows content creators to easily provide narration for videos without having to record it perfectly in one take or worry about editing sound clips together! Have you heard the AI-sounding voices while scrolling TikTok or Instagram Reels? That’s an example of TTS technology in action!

TTS technology with native social media platform editing tools is relatively limited, however. Using an AI text to speech app, conversely, can provide you content creators with a wider variety of voices, accents, and languages to choose from. AI text to speech technology is also ideal for content creators who are uncomfortable using their own voice to narrate. This could be because of anything from speech complications or performance anxiety to language barriers or simply not wanting to use their own voice.
